Index Funds are types of mutual funds or ETFs that aim to replicate the performance of a specific index The first Index Fund, Vanguard 500 Index Fund, was created in the 1970s by John Bogle, the founder of the Vanguard Group Today, popular Index Funds include the Vanguard 500 Index Fund (VFIAX) and Fidelity ZERO Total Market Index Fund (FZROX)

Index funds are a type of mutual fund or ETF So when you’re shopping for index funds, you may come across index mutual funds or index ETFs (which can get confusing, we know!) No matter the structure, an important thing to know about index funds is that they follow a specific investment strategy
